“…7,26,72 The SOCIAL HF pilot study used the COM-B/BCW framework to systematically improve the decision-making process in allocating advanced HF therapies by using evidencebased strategies that affect an individual's capability, opportunity, and motivation for change. 28 The intervention included longitudinal trainings on implementation of antiracism and bias reduction strategies, use of more objective assessments of social support and adherence, and strategies to improve group dynamics. The study used a mixed-methods design with preintervention and postintervention testing incorporating normalization process theory (framework for developing, implementing, and evaluating a complex system-level intervention 73 ) for evaluation.…”
